Bear, (sculpture).
Artist:
Bough, Doug, sculptor.
Title:
Bear, (sculpture).
Digital Reference:
Medium:
Sculpture: probably elm; Base: probably elm.
Dimensions:
Sculpture: approx. 4 ft. 9 in. x 21 in. x 17 in.; Base: approx. 9 x 22 x 22 in.
Inscription:
unsigned
Description:
A bear carved from a dead tree trunk stands on its hind legs with its forelegs hanging in front and its head turned to its proper left. The surface of the bear is covered with long gouges to simulate fur.
